"The Protozoan Nucleus: Morphology and Evolution" by Igor B. Raikov is a seminal work in the field of cell biology, specifically focusing on protozoa. Here is a comprehensive overview of the book:

Key Themes

  1. Protozoan Nucleus Structure: The book delves into the detailed morphology of the nucleus in protozoa, exploring its structure, organization, and function.
  2. Evolutionary Aspects: It examines the evolutionary history of protozoan nuclei, discussing how these structures have developed and diversified over time.
  3. Comparative Analysis: The book provides a comparative analysis of different protozoan species, highlighting the unique features of their nuclei.
